Environmental Impact Analysis



Solar power provides an appealing option to conventional power resources due to its significantly reduced ecological impact. Unlike fossil fuels that emit harmful greenhouse gases and contribute to air contamination, solar power generates power without producing any emissions.

The process of harnessing solar energy includes recording sunshine with photovoltaic panels, which doesn't release any kind of contaminants right into the ambience. This lack of emissions helps in reducing the carbon impact connected with energy production, making solar energy a cleaner and much more lasting choice.

Furthermore, the use of solar power contributes to preservation initiatives by minimizing the demand for finite resources like coal, oil, and natural gas. By relying on the sunlight's abundant and renewable resource resource, we can aid preserve all-natural environments, safeguard environments, and reduce the adverse influences of resource extraction.

Dependability and Power Landscape Assessment



For a comprehensive evaluation of dependability and the power landscape, it's essential to review exactly how solar power compares to typical sources. Solar energy is gaining ground as a reliable and sustainable energy source. While conventional resources like coal, oil, and natural gas have actually been traditionally dominant, they're limited and contribute to environmental degradation.

Solar energy, on the other hand, is abundant and sustainable, making it a much more lasting option in the future.

In terms of dependability, solar power can be dependent on climate condition and sunlight schedule. However, improvements in modern technology have actually resulted in the growth of power storage solutions like batteries, enhancing the integrity of solar energy systems. Standard sources, on the other hand, are prone to price fluctuations, geopolitical tensions, and supply chain interruptions, making them much less reputable in the long-term.

When evaluating the energy landscape, solar energy uses decentralized power production, reducing transmission losses and increasing power safety and security. Typical sources, with their centralized nuclear power plant, are extra at risk to interruptions and call for considerable facilities for distribution.
